There are some other changes too though,
Stainless Steel exhaust system
Improved stereo
The electric passenger seat (already mentoned)
Chrome front speaker grilles
Piping on the leather seats
A proper rear view mirror, not those silly convex ones!!
Think thats pretty much it...
